Change subject: gbproxy: Fix several tests on titan 11 ......................................................................
gbproxy: Fix several tests on titan 11
Rework altsteps to avoid race condition showing up under titan 11.1.0. It's not really clear whether the previous implementation is actually expected/permitted by TTCN-3, where an altstep variable is initialized multiple times with different values through activate(). In any case, the new implementation is much cleaner, only requiring 1 altstep instead of N.
